Cost of living comparison
United States is 33.0% more expensive than Quebec City.

The cost of childcare, housing, entertainment and sports, groceries, and restaurants in United States are more expensive than in Quebec City. Expenses including clothing and transportation are lower in United States. Notably, childcare is significantly more expensive in United States.
